Salman Khan Issues Legal Notice Against ‘Kala Hiran’ Film Makers

News Mania Desk/ Piyal Chatterjee/ 2nd June 2026

Bollywood star Salman Khan has sent a legal notice to the makers of the upcoming film Kala Hiran: The Battle for Legacy, objecting to its content and promotional campaign. The move has intensified controversy around the project, which is reportedly based on events linked to the actor’s blackbuck poaching case and other widely publicised incidents from his life.

According to reports, Salman Khan’s legal team has demanded an immediate halt to the film’s promotion and release-related activities. The notice reportedly seeks the withdrawal of posters, teasers and other promotional material, while warning of further legal action if the filmmakers fail to comply with the demands.

The film is being produced by Amit Jani and directed by Bharat S. Shrinate. Marketed as a crime drama inspired by real-life events, the project has generated attention due to its alleged references to the 1998 blackbuck hunting case involving Salman Khan. Reports suggest that the storyline may also touch upon the ongoing tensions between the actor and gangster Lawrence Bishnoi, making the subject matter particularly sensitive.

Responding to the legal notice, producer Amit Jani said the filmmakers would not be intimidated and intended to continue with the project. He maintained that the film is based on publicly available information and defended the team’s decision to proceed with its production and promotion.

The dispute has sparked considerable discussion within the film industry and among fans, with many closely watching the developments. Legal experts believe the matter could eventually reach the courts if both sides fail to arrive at a resolution.

The controversy comes at a crucial stage for the film, with its teaser launch reportedly scheduled in the coming weeks. As the legal battle unfolds, the future of Kala Hiran remains uncertain. Industry observers say the outcome could have significant implications for filmmakers producing projects inspired by real-life personalities and events.
